Don’t Ignore These Warning Signs of Crawl Space Water Damage

Ignoring signs of water damage in your crawl space can lead to costly repairs, health hazards, and even structural issues. Here are some warning signs to watch out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ent, musty smell in your crawl space could show hidden moisture, mold growth, or water damage. Don’t ignore it!

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Visible water stains on walls or ceilings often signal a larger issue, including water damage, mold growth, or structural problems.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of hidden water damage, which can compromise the structural integrity of your home.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Mold or mildew growth in your crawl space can lead to serious health issues and costly repairs. Don’t wait to address it.

Excessive Humidity or Condensation

Unusually high humidity levels or excessive condensation in your crawl space can show hidden water damage or a larger issue.

Noticeable Water Leaks

Visible water leaks in your crawl space or surrounding areas can signal a range of problems, from simple leaks to more complex issues.

Crawl Space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age in a small crawl space, less than 100 sq. Ft. Yes No DIY methods can handle minor damage.
Water damage in a crawl space with standing water over 1 inch deep. No Yes Standing water poses health risks and needs specialized equipment for safe removal.
Water damage in a crawl space with extensive mold or mildew growth. No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ized cleaning and removal techniques to ensure occupant safety.
Water damage in a crawl space with structural damage or warping. No Yes Structural damage needs professional assessment and repair to prevent further issues.
Water damage in a crawl space with a complex or large area. No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to effectively handle large or complex water damage situations.
Water damage in a crawl space with a hidden moisture issue. No Yes Hidden moisture needs specialized equipment to detect and address.

Crawl Space Water Removal Cost in Coalville, UT

The cost of crawl space water removal in Coalville, UT,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a general estimate of what you might exp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, amount of standing water, and equipment usage.
Dehumidification and drying $200 – $1,500 Size of affected area, humidity levels, and equipment usage.
Inspection and assessment $100 – $500 Scope of damage, size of affected area, and complexity of issue.
Mold and mildew remediation $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of mold growth, size of affected area, and equipment usage.
Structural repair and replacement $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of structural damage, size of affected area, and materials needed.
Follow-up visits and monitoring $100 – $500 Frequency of visits, size of affected area, and equipment usage.
